  5. 2024 Season: Brake Hardware Recap

    I've noticed the same -- and IIRC it was more so on the inner right pad for me -- but that might be track/use dependent, as that's the side that is loaded up the most. I flip my pads every few events. I flip outside to inside opposite side of car, and vice versa in order to maximize pad life.

  18. Racing the FL5 Type R with all OEM spec parts on Laguna Seca

    The HO will definitely have HO stamped on the sidewall. I've had them. They are also both 240TW...the HO is not lower treadwear. Keep an eye on the center out rib...it's going to get torn up with understeer. Kinda standard Cup2 bullsh*t, but it's amplified on FWD with minimal camber
